  1. Is there anyone here that works for a dealership or Lincoln Financial server that can confirm something about Lincoln loyalty rate reduction on new leases. At first I was told that since I have a 2016 Lincoln MKX, i am eligible for a 1% lease rate reduction on getting my new 2019 Nautilus. Then our sales guy comes back from the sales manager and tells us that since our 2016 was used (but Certified Pre-owned), I am not eligible for the 1% rate reduction. It only applies if I purchased the car brand new. To me its complete BS, as a loyalty plan should be that I own a Lincoln and I am getting a new one. Has anyone come across this? Sean
